    Peningkatan Motivasi dan Prestasi Belajar Menulis Teks Eksposisi Menggunakan Model Discokaku Dipadu Gambar Berseri di SMA Negeri 5 Magelang

    This research was aimed to investigate students' motivation and their learning achievement in writing exposition texts. To seek the answer, we used discokaku teaching method and pictorial series. This study was carried out under classroom action research. We implemented three main stages of pre-cycle, cycle I, and cycle II, each cycle using three meetings. The participants were 10th graders of SMA Negeri 5 Magelang. The data were attained from test and non-test techniques. The test technique deployed (1) Kahoot! for assessing their understanding and (2) pictorial series for the writing test. For the non-test, this study adopted some qualitative instruments: journal, observation, interview, and documentation. The result shows that discokaku teaching method and pictorial series were able to improve students’ motivation from 23.47% to 33.87% and their achievement from 3.13% to 78.13% at the end of the cycle 2

    Keterancaman Leksikon dan Kearifan Lokal dalam Perkakas Pertanian Tradisional Jawa

    This research is aimed to (1) identify the noun phrases of the endangered traditional farming tools, (2) explain the values of local wisdom which are reflected in traditional farming tools in Java, and (3) explain the efforts that can be done to conserve the noun phrases of the endangered traditional farming tools in Java. The research data consist of many kinds of noun phrases of traditional farming tools in Java in every speech act by the traditional farmer from Javanese ethnic that is gotten from the interview and observation in Magelang district and Sleman district. The verbal data were collected with an observation method. The result of this research showed that 46.3% respondent knew any number of noun phrases in the questionnaire. In reverse, 53.7% respondent did not know any number of noun phrases in the questionnaire. The local wisdom found in this research were the meanings from the noun phrases of traditional farming tools in Java. The meanings have certain values of local wisdom with the beneficial aims for human life.  Furthermore, the efforts that can be done to conserve traditional farming tools in Java are (1) exposing this research in a form of article and journal about traditional farming tools, (2) socializing traditional farming tools in Java through explaining and showing pictures to respondents who have filled the questionnaire. This socialisation is done by giving pictures of traditional farming tools in Java and explaining about the function

    Simbolisme dalam Novel Jakarta Sebelum Pagi Karya Ziggy Zezsyazeoviennazabrizkie Kajian Semiotika Komunikasi

    This Novel Jakarta Sebelum Pagi by Ziggy Zezsyazeoviennazabrizkie examines stories of love nuances which also contain socio-cultural elements in the modern era with a comparison of past stories to support the moral values presented. This study aims to examine abstract symbols so that multiple interpretations are made art connoisseurs. The author uses a type of qualitative research with a content analysis approach. Data was collected by grouping quotations between conversations between Abel's figure and other figures who shared similarity with symbolism in communication semiotics, namely symbolism of loyalty, trust, caring and habit. The results of the study which showed the discovery of four symbolism is as follows. First, the symbol of commitment is demonstrated by the blue Hyacinth flower that the character always brings to his lover. Second, trust is shown by pigs which are believed to have high ability to capture and intelligence, so that a symbol of a pig represents the character of Nissa (someone who can be trusted). Third, the concern is shown by grunts and growls by figures who cannot communicate using the five senses. Fourth, the custom symbol is illustrated by smoked pigs which are already polluted pollution in the city of Jakarta every day. The four symbols can be found in the discussion of imaginary novels

    Homonimi dan Polisemi pada Unggahan Jenaka di Instagram

    This study is inspired by the use of Instagram as social media that is liked by Indonesian people. From 265, 4 million Indonesian people in 2018, 120 million people are users of social media. Fifty-three million out of 120 million people are the active users of Instagram in Indonesia. Instead of uploading the daily photos, Indonesian people are fond of posting jokes as the representative of social life. Those jokes use language as the primary medium. The use of words utilizes polysemy and homonymy for showing double meaning, so it represents jokes. This qualitative study uses the data of humorous postings on Instagram. After analyzing the data, it is found that the dominant aspects are polysemy and homonymy. Polysemy is shown by the transfer of meaning, the use of terms, and metaphor. Homonymy is viewed by the usage of language tendency, the use of names or titles, the abbreviation, and the divergence of meaning

    Language Interference of Bimanese to the Indonesian Language: A Case Study of Community in Kampung Muhajirin, Bima

    This research is initiated by the error use of Indonesian language by the community living in Kampung Muhajirin, Bima due to interference phenomenon. The errors occur in various linguistic aspects. This study aims to determine the interference forms of Bimanese language to the Indonesian language based on the characteristics differences between Bimanese and Indonesian language. One of the most distinct characteristics of both languages is that Bimanese is a vocalist language, while the Indonesian language is not a vocalist. The data were collected by observation and recording technique. The researchers observed the linguistic phenomenon in Kampung Muhajirin and recorded by a tape recorder. Finally, the data were analyzed and transcribed in orthographic writing. The finding showed that the interference of Bimanese language to the Indonesian language occurs on the aspects of phonological, lexical, and grammatical. Phonological interference causes the vowel sound disappeared at the end of the word. Lexical interference causes mixed code. Grammatical interference causes word order error
